OUTSTANDING 19TH CENTURY HOOKED RUNNER. Very rare form in an antique hooked rug. Hooked with cotton, wool and hemp. Circa 1880’s. The central rectangular field in a mottled black/green/gray has three opposing lyre forms formed with S-scrolls in red, yellow and green. Separated by two thistle branches having three red thistles and green leaves. The border with opposing triangles alternating in different colors. Found in Downeast Maine. SIZE: 105” l x 18” w. CONDITION: Very good. This rug was found in two pieces, which had binding. The binding was removed and the original ends were sewn together. We believe there was no loss to the ends that met and actually, because it was hidden by the border, the original colors show brighter. A most interesting folk art rug. 9-99229 (9,000-12,000)
